My recommendation would be to get a well cared for private party truck. Then have it checked out by a reputable INDY shop. Might take some time, but will save you many headaches in the future.
Potential problem with buying from a buyer/fixer is that they need to make the maximum profit from each sale. This often necessitates doing the bare minimum just to get it off the lot. Cheap parts, steam cleaning engine compartment/chassis to hide leaks, no service records, etc...
Regardless of how "mechanically inclined" you are, the whole idea of owning a vehicle is to drive it. Start putting huge amounts of time and money into it and your love affair will sour quickly.
